What is the expected network performance of a VNET jail for network
communication between the jail and the host, or between multiple jails? I
expected it to approach the 10Gbps of the epair device, but I'm not seeing
that.

I see between 800 - 1200 Mbps in standard iperf tests both between the host
bridge interface and the vnet jail inteface. I see the same poor speeds if
I make 2 vnet jails and put one side of the epair in each and test between
them.

Is the overhead of vnet causing this? Is there anything I can do to improve
this performance.

I've tested and seen similar performance on 10.0-RELEASE and 11.0-CURRENT.
